Balancing need and risk, supply and demand: Developing a tool to prioritize naloxone distribution
Claire A Wood1, Lauren Green1, Anna La Manna1
1Missouri Institute of Mental Health, University of Missouri-St. Louis, St Louis, MO, USA.

Area of Science:
- Public Health
- Emergency Medicine
- Data Science in Healthcare
Background:
- National opioid overdose deaths are increasing.
- Demand for naloxone, an opioid overdose antidote, exceeds supply.
- Prioritization tools are needed for effective naloxone distribution.
Purpose of the Study:
- To develop a data-driven tool for prioritizing naloxone distribution.
- To create a standardized Naloxone Request Form (NRF) and prioritization algorithm.
- To improve the efficiency of distributing limited naloxone supplies.
Main Methods:
- Developed a standardized Naloxone Request Form (NRF).
- Created a weighted prioritization algorithm for naloxone distribution.
- Compared historical distribution with algorithm-generated priority quintiles.
Main Results:
- The NRF and algorithm successfully prioritized agencies by potential impact.
- Naloxone was distributed more to higher-priority agencies.
- The algorithm revealed limitations of the 'first come, first served' distribution method.
Conclusions:
- The developed tool provides a foundation for prospective, data-driven naloxone distribution.
- The tool is flexible and adaptable for various programs and locations.
- Ensures limited naloxone supplies have the greatest impact on overdose prevention.
